REV. EDWARD
LAI
ASSISTANT VICE PRESIDENT OF BUSINESS DEVELOPMENT
BENSONHURST CENTER FOR REHAB AND HEALTHCARE
The Rev. Edward Lai has been serving as the Assistant Vice President of Business Development
at Bensonhurst Center, Hopkins Center and Fairview Nursing Care Center. During
the heights of the COVID-19pandemic, he was part of the Bensonhurst and Fairview teams
alongside nursing and medical that go into the facilities daily to work on post acute placements
in nursing homes, assisting social workers and nurse case managers in serving the
needs for those who needed sub acute rehab and skilled nursing services being discharged
from hospitals.
The services his facilities provided ensured hospitals have enough beds open up to treat
COVID-19patients. Although not a licensed medical professional, but an essential worker,
Rev. Lai had daily contact with families and residents during this extreme hard time, he solved
problems and concerns and provided a certain level of comfort to residents and families.
He has led the initiatives in the distribution of 80,000–100,000PPE and 2months of adult
diapers for 200people to the community via Chung Pak Local Development and other community
based organizations for the older adults population.
Rev. Lai has been a member of the leadership council of Chinese-American Planning Council,
the board of Healthcare Choices NY Community Health Center, the Chinese-American
Community Service Center, and various others. A three term member of Brooklyn Community
Boards (7and 11), Rev. Lai has been appointed to DYCD Neighborhood Advisory Board 11by
Brooklyn Borough President Eric Adams in 2019. He was recently listed on the Points of Light
George H.W Bush Award Celebration Inspiration Honor Roll.
